
Google Maps Enhances Privacy by Storing Timeline Data On-Device
Google Maps is removing the Timeline feature from its web version, pushing users to access their location history via the mobile app instead. This change, effective from December 1, 2024, aims to give users more control over their data by storing it on their devices rather than Google's servers. Users must switch to the app to retain their Timeline data, or it will be auto-deleted. The transition has received mixed reactions from users.
